Travelling from Venice to London Heathrow Airport (LHR): What you need to know

  • There are a couple of airports you can start your journey from in Venice. Check out your options leaving from Venice Marco Polo Airport (VCE) or Treviso Airport (TSF) when searching for a flight from Venice to London Heathrow Airport (LHR).

  • Book a direct Venice to London Heathrow Airport flight and you'll be travelling for an average of 2 hours 25 minutes.

  • The timezone in London is UTC+0, which is one hour behind Venice. London Heathrow Airport is located in London.

  • With 32 direct weekly flights between the two airports, Venice Marco Polo Airport (VCE) to London Heathrow Airport (LHR) is the busiest route. British Airways operates the earliest flight at 7am. If you prefer to make the most of your day before you fly, the latest flight from VCE to LHR is with British Airways at 9:30pm.

  • Leave enough time to catch your flight from Venice to LHR. It's generally best to arrive at least two hours before international departures and an hour ahead for domestic flights.

  • Delays at security and check-in are more likely if you're jetting off during high season, so give yourself some extra breathing space. The recommendation for peak periods? Arrive up to four hours ahead for international flights and at least two hours for domestic departures.

Treviso Airport (TSF)

  • TSF is about 40 kilometres from central Venice. It'll take you 35 minutes or so to get to the airport by car from the city centre. Public transport takes roughly 1 hour 15 minutes.

About London Heathrow Airport (LHR)

Getting from London Heathrow Airport (LHR) to central London

  • Central London is around 26 kilometres from London Heathrow Airport. Journey times by cab or car hire will vary depending on time of day and traffic conditions, so do some research ahead of your trip.

  • Travelling on public transport typically takes 1 hour.

The best time to fly from Venice to London Heathrow Airport (LHR)

  • July is the most popular month for flights from Venice to London Heathrow Airport (LHR). Visit London in February if you'd rather avoid peak season.

  • The warmest month in London is July, with temperatures ranging between 11ºC (52ºF) and 26ºC (79ºF). Lock in your Venice to LHR plane ticket then if you enjoy this type of weather.

  • January sees temperatures of between 0ºC (32ºF) and 9ºC (48ºF). Look for cheap tickets from Venice to London Heathrow Airport around that time if you want to travel when it's cooler.
